Spredox D-242 Dispersant

Spredox D-242 Dispersant is a high-performance polymeric dispersant from Spredox’s D-series, designed for pigment stabilization in water-based coatings and inks. It enhances color strength, reduces viscosity, and improves grind efficiency while offering excellent shelf-life stability and low foaming. Compatible with acrylics, styrene-acrylics, and PUDs, it ensures uniform dispersion without compromising film integrity or gloss.

Features Of Spredox D-242 Dispersant

  1. High-efficiency steric and electrostatic stabilization for pigment and filler suspensions.

  2. Excellent compatibility with aqueous and solvent-based systems, including acrylics, polyurethanes, and alkyds.

  3. Low foaming profile, minimizing process interruptions in high-shear dispersion equipment.

  4. Enhanced storage stability—prevents settling and hard agglomeration over extended periods.

  5. Non-ionic, low-VOC formulation supporting regulatory compliance (REACH, TSCA).

Typical Applications Of Spredox D-242 Dispersant

  1. Architectural and industrial waterborne paints and coatings.

  2. Automotive OEM and refinish basecoat and primer surfacers.

  3. Inkjet inks for wide-format and packaging applications.

  4. Construction adhesives and cementitious tile grouts.

  5. Specialty functional coatings (e.g., anti-corrosive primers, UV-curable systems).

Specifications Of Spredox D-242 Dispersant

Chemical TypeNon-ionic polymeric dispersant (modified polyester backbone)
Product FormClear to slightly hazy amber liquid
AppearanceHomogeneous free-flowing liquid
Primary ApplicationsPigment dispersion in waterborne and solvent-borne coatings, inks, and construction additives
Key FeaturesSteric stabilization, low foaming, broad resin compatibility
BenefitsImproved color strength, reduced grinding time, enhanced gloss and transparency
pH (1% aqueous solution)6.0 – 7.5
Specific Gravity (25°C)1.03 – 1.07 g/cm³
